There are dozens of sound files never used in the retail game. Some include full conversations, and many have generic voices that were to be re-recorded later. Several conversations in the retail version were shortened from the prototype.

C17
Presumably early versions of Breen's Speeches.
| Sound | Filename | Dialogue | Note |
|---|---|---|---|
| c17pa0.wav | The true citizen knows that duty is the greatest gift. | ||
| c17pa1.wav | The true citizen appreciates the comforts of City 17, but uses discretion. | ||
| c17pa2.wav | The true citizen's identiband is kept clean and visible at all times. | ||
| c17pa3.wav | The true citizen's job is the opposite of slavery. | ||
| c17pa4.wav | The true citizen conserves valuable oxygen. |

Trans6
There's an unused audio file called "Trans6" that was later deleted in the final and is... frightening... It was later found to be a distorted recording by the Judica-Cordiglia brothers in 1963, which they believed to be a Russian astronaut who burned up in the Earth's atmosphere as she commented on seeing flames and feeling hot before asking if she was going to crash.
